Snd is a sound editor modeled loosely after Emacs and an old, sorely-missed PDP-10 sound editor named Dpysnd. It can accommodate any number of sounds, each with any number of channels, and can be customized and extended using Guile, Ruby or Forth. Included with it are some command-line utilities: - snd-info (note: renamed from sndinfo, for this FreeBSD port) prints a description of a sound file. - sndplay plays a sound file. - sndrecord records sound from a microphone. - audinfo describes the current state of the audio hardware.
